NDP, Sask. Party spar over education funding
Education funding was the main topic of discussion at Question Period on Tuesday at the Saskatchewan Legislature.
Earlier in the day on the steps of the Legislature, the NDP and Canadian Union of Public Employees (CUPE) voiced their concerns regarding the lack of education funding in the provincial budget.
This past spring’s budget saw an additional $1.8 million given to 27 school divisions to cover what the government called “additional substitute teacher and other school-based employee costs.”
That also includes educational assistants (EAs).
